[PATCH] memcg: avoid accessing memcg after releasing reference

From: Li Zefan
Date: Sun Mar 31 2013 - 22:39:34 EST


This might cause use-after-free bug.

mm/memcontrol.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/mm/memcontrol.c b/mm/memcontrol.c
index 8ec501c..6391046 100644
--- a/mm/memcontrol.c
+++ b/mm/memcontrol.c
@@ -3186,12 +3186,12 @@ void memcg_release_cache(struct kmem_cache *s)

root = s->memcg_params->root_cache;
root->memcg_params->memcg_caches[id] = NULL;
- mem_cgroup_put(memcg);

mutex_lock(&memcg->slab_caches_mutex);
list_del(&s->memcg_params->list);
mutex_unlock(&memcg->slab_caches_mutex);

+ mem_cgroup_put(memcg);
out:
kfree(s->memcg_params);
}
